(c)AKAKE

サーバー遅い?2

category :[雑談] [開発] edit
も少し詳しくやってみた

スーパーπ104万桁
現行サーバー 147.190(4.220) Sec.
 新サーバー 80.553(1.928) Sec

新しいサーバーの圧勝

先日のテストプログラム(prg.2)に、手作業で高速化修正(構造体配列を参照化)をかけたもの(prg.1)
とでの比較。 それぞれのサーバーでコンパイルして、-O3の最適化あるなし
全8種のプログラムをそれぞれのサーバー上で動作させてみて時間を計測してみた
環境gccprg最適化無し-O3最適化
新サーバー3.3prg.130.076s14.757s
prg.233.551s14.722s
4.3prg.131.491s14.057s
prg.235.257s14.063s
現行サーバー3.3prg.132.889s15.512s
prg.229.463s13.471s
4.3prg.148.109s14.552s
prg.246.341s14.571s


えーと、まとめると
最適化を指定しない場合 gcc4.3はgcc3.3に性能で劣る
最適化O3を指定すると、基本gcc4.3が性能が上だけど 一部例外がある

現行サーバーと新サーバーでは 新サーバーの方が高速。

現行サーバー、3.3、prg.2がなぜ一番早いかも謎




posted by AKAKE at 2009/05/12 16:28

Notice: Undefined index: HTTP_REFERER in /home/cosmosa/www/blog/topic.php on line 123